Given numbers are 20/83,147/44,885/309

Formula to find LCM of Fractions is

LCM = LCM of Numerators/GCF of Denominators

As per the formula LCM of Fractions let’s split into two parts and find the LCM of Numerators and GCF of Denominators

In the given fractions LCM of Numerators means LCM of 20,147,885

Least Common Multiple of Numerators i.e. LCM of 20,147,885 is 173460.

GCF of Denominators means GCF of 83,44,309 as per the given fractions.

GCF of 83,44,309 is 1 as it is the largest common factor for these numbers.
